The Canadian Onsite Wastewater Training Initiative (COWTI) is an independent training organization. We are proud to offer blended learning courses that are self-paced for the onsite wastewater industry in Canada.

 

Mission Statement

To provide high quality, professional training to the onsite wastewater industry through engaging and diverse classroom and field programs.

 

Our courses are approved by the regulating bodies in each province and run by instructors and industry experts. The courses are predominantly online and users can login at any time to complete the units at their own pace. Certain courses have live online tutorials, and our larger courses offer in-person field training days at our Soils Training Facility and Field Shop near Edmonton, Alberta.

Our Team

Dean Morin

P.Eng., M.Sc., B.Sc.

Founder & Lead Technical Instructor

Dean was the Provincial Administrator of Private Sewage Systems for the Government of Alberta in the Ministry of Municipal Affairs from 2016 – 2021. He was instrumental in initiating many of the changes made in the 2021 Alberta Private Sewage Standard of Practice (SOP). Dean’s love for teaching and instructing has been a passion of his within the private sewage industry, having done hundreds of different industry talks over his 25+ year career in onsite wastewater. Before his role as a Private Sewage Safety Codes Officer, Dean was a environmental remediation consultant at sites in Alberta, the National Parks and the Arctic. Dean is a registered Environmental Engineer in Alberta and completed his Master’s of Science in Geo-environmental Engineering at the University of Alberta. Dean’s love for knowledge and research has brought him back to academia, as he is currently engaged in his PhD program with the University of Calgary.
